Weight Loss Advice for Every Day 7

Welcome to another article in my series of weight loss advice for every day. Today we’ll look at exercise in more detail. We all know that exercise is an important part of any weight loss program.

1. Check your weight before you start your exercise routine and keep checking for changes. But do not expect a radical change immediately. It might be one or two weeks before you notice some weight loss. In fact, your weight may increase for a bit as you turn fat into muscle. However it is crucial that you continue to monitor your weight. Even a few pounds or inches lost is a big achievement.

2. When you do notice a change, reward yourself. Now, don’t go for some goodies like chocolates or sweets. After all, this is a weight loss program! Maybe you could go for a movie or buy yourself something like a new dress or a trinket. This is something that can keep you going.

3. You can take a day off from exercise every week. This is not just a very good idea but it is part of the exercise routine. Your body needs a day off from an exercise routine.

4. Exercise outdoors as often as possible. There are two advantages of exercising outside. One advantage is that it gives your body a chance to get much needed fresh air and sunshine. The second advantage is that the surroundings keep you perked up and it is a break from remaining cooped up all day long

5. Try to collect some information about exercise. There are a lot of things that you can do at home. Extensive research has been done on exercise and plenty of this information is easily available. You can try browsing the net or getting a book or two on how to exercise at home. This information will be useful to you to know how much you need to work out on each specific exercise in order to burn off the desired number of calories.

6. Try to get somebody to exercise along with you. It should be somebody committed to exercise and/or weight loss or else your interest might dwindle. One of the advantages of getting a committed person to exercise with you is that it keeps you going. There may be days when you feel just too lazy to crawl out of bed in the mornings. On such days, the knowledge that somebody is waiting for you is enough to slide out of bed. Another advantage is that you can discuss your progress and fears with another person and be a sympathetic listener to the other person as well. This is a great way to get motivated your self.

Fast, quick or rapid weight loss, involves losing weight quickly, generally within the first few days or so. Every year, in the USA, many hundred thousand Americans get motivated by the idea of rapid weight loss.

Often times overweight people have an urge to lose weight before an important event, like an upcoming vacation or a wedding. Although it is reasonable how you can want to lose weight as fast as possible, you need to proceed with caution.

Yes, it is quite possible to lose some amount of weight, rapidly at least initially, but don’t ignore the associated dangers.

Many people living in the Western World are tending to obesity and should seriously consider going on a diet before they suffer major health causes of concern. Fast weight loss is the thing that most of us would probably be most interested in, but most health professionals would advise against it, with regards to “immediate” weight loss, as health problems often follow unless carefully monitored.

It can affect your health if you lose weight too quickly, because of several reasons: The initial pounds that you shed are mainly due to losing stored water and not really due to shedding fat which can have consequential dangers for your health like dehydration; it is all too easy then to turn to carbonated drinks to satisfy your thirst, and usually there is too much sugar in carbonated drinks which can lead to an imbalance of blood sugar which can lead to diabetes, and the carbon dioxide in the fizzy drinks can cause the stomach to bloat and some embarrassing problems of wind.

It is very easy to get very hungry and consequently over-eat and over-drink and as a result putting all the lost weight on again. So fast weight loss is not generally a very good idea.
